Prediction is bettered: not always accurate, but can translate into details/factors that we can take into consideration when dealing with certain issues. Urbanization: also relevant to the wider control of the government, seeing more and more of a beuarocratization of the state as opposed to the control of the church. Dangerous classes: threat, need for state to have info on citizens. Interest in trying to gain as much information as possible on each person so that we can learn to better manage and control these populations. Especially needed to collect info on those who pose a possible threat: need to control. The only way we can do this is if we have additional information about them. Massive infiltration of the state and the interest of the state with certain individuals. Series of documents that gathered information on the details of crimes (times of the year, gender/sex/education level of offender), acquittals and other processes related to the court, convictions, punishments.
